WORLD ORGANIZATION Meaning and Definition

  1. A world organization is a global institution that aims to facilitate international cooperation and promote peace, security, development, and cooperation among nations. It serves as a platform for nations to engage in dialogue, address common challenges and issues, and make collective decisions in order to enhance global governance and address shared concerns.

    World organizations bring together member states from around the world in a structured and systematic manner. They operate through a set of principles, treaties, and agreements that guide their activities and decision-making processes. These organizations cover a wide range of areas, including politics, economics, trade, health, security, human rights, and the environment.

    The primary purpose of a world organization is to mediate conflicts, prevent wars, and maintain international peace and security. These organizations often develop mechanisms for peaceful resolution of disputes, facilitate negotiations, and enforce compliance with international law. Additionally, they promote economic development, reduce poverty, and address global challenges such as climate change, terrorism, and epidemics through coordinated and collaborative efforts among member nations.

    Some prominent examples of world organizations include the United Nations (UN), World Health Organization (WHO), World Trade Organization (WTO), International Monetary Fund (IMF), and World Bank. These institutions play a vital role in shaping international relations, fostering cooperation among nations, and striving for a more peaceful, just, and prosperous world.

Etymology of WORLD ORGANIZATION

The word "world" derived from the Old English word "werold", which means "age of humanity" or "human existence". It is a combination of "wer", meaning "man" or "human", and "ald", meaning "age" or "age of". Over time, "werold" transformed into "world" in modern English.

The word "organization" originated from the Latin word "organizare", which means "to arrange or order". It stems from the word "organum", referring to a musical instrument or tool. In the mid-15th century, it entered Middle French as "organisation" with the same meaning, and eventually, it made its way into English as "organization".

When the words "world" and "organization" are combined, "world organization" refers to a structured framework or entity that operates on a global scale or encompasses the entire world.
